What Sets the Contrasting Maxi Print Apart

The appeal of a maxi print is its instant impact. Instead of a small chest logo that disappears under layers, an oversized graphic reads from across the room and turns a simple outfit into a look.

  • Maxi-scale graphic placement creates a high-impact finish even with straightforward jeans or tailored trousers.
  • The contrasting print creates clear visual separation, which makes layering easier—outerwear, open shirts, or blazers won’t feel “busy” as long as the rest stays clean.
  • It performs well as a single “hero item” outfit: keep the palette neutral and let the print lead.

For a polished result, treat the tee like you would a bold jacket: give it space. Minimal jewelry, quieter textures, and solid-color bottoms help the graphic look intentional rather than loud.

Fabric Feel and Everyday Comfort

Cotton is a strong baseline for daily wear because it’s breathable, flexible, and generally easy to care for. The structure of a well-made cotton tee also matters: it can hold a cleaner silhouette, especially when worn with sharper pieces like wool trousers or a blazer.

  • Cotton construction supports breathability for all-season wear—solo in warm weather, layered in cooler months.
  • A more structured cotton tee typically holds shape better than ultra-thin jersey, which helps when styling with tailored or angular silhouettes.
  • For sensitive skin, cotton is often a comfortable default; check the garment label for any added blends or special finishes.

Fit and Sizing Notes to Consider

Maxi-print tees look different depending on how they sit on the shoulders and torso. Before choosing a size, decide how the shirt will be used most: as a base layer under outerwear, or as the main visual statement.

  • Pick the intended look first: a closer fit works well under a jacket, while a relaxed fit reads more street and makes the tee the centerpiece.
  • Check shoulder seams and sleeve length—these define the silhouette, and they also affect where the graphic lands.
  • If between sizes, consider the print scale on the torso: a larger size can feel more “poster-like,” while a smaller size can look sharper and more refined.

For styling consistency, also pay attention to length. If the hem hits mid-hip, it’s easier to wear untucked with denim; if it runs longer, consider a half-tuck or pairing with slimmer bottoms for balance.

Styling Ideas: From Minimal to Street

A contrasting maxi print gives plenty of direction—so the rest of the outfit can stay straightforward. The easiest wins come from strong silhouettes and restrained color choices.

  • Minimal: black straight-leg denim and clean sneakers. Keep the print as the only high-contrast element.
  • Tailored edge: tuck or half-tuck into wool trousers, add a blazer, and keep accessories sleek and tonal.
  • Street layer: wear it under an oversized denim jacket and finish with chunky soles or streamlined boots.
  • Color strategy: echo one shade from the print in a hat, bag, or sneakers to make the outfit feel cohesive.

FAQ

How should a maxi-print T-shirt fit?

Choose a closer fit if it will be worn under jackets or blazers, and a relaxed fit if it’s meant to be the main statement piece. Check shoulder seams, chest room, and overall length so the graphic lands where it looks balanced on your torso.

How can the print be protected during washing?

Wash the tee inside out on a gentle cycle with cool or lukewarm water and a mild detergent. Avoid high-heat drying, and iron inside out (or with a pressing cloth) to keep the printed area crisp.

What bottoms work best with a bold contrasting print tee?

Neutral denim, tailored trousers, and other minimal bottoms work best because they let the graphic lead. Keeping colors simple helps prevent clashing and makes the outfit look clean and intentional.
